Is Mold A Concern?

Mold is a fungus that disseminates through the air as spores, eventually settling on natural materials where they become observable as they grow. Mold often appears as fuzzy splotches and can be nearly any color, including white, green, yellow, and black. Certain types of black mold are more often considered a health hazard and can cause allergic reactions in at-risk people and pets. The major threat is the detriment mold can do to a structure. Not only is the fungus unsightly and produces a foul odor, but there are also many common materials used to build homes and possessions inside that it will occupy and consume. Over time, the fungus can spread throughout a structure and damage many of the vital structural components, including:

  • Drywall
  • Wood
  • Carpet
  • Insulation
  • Ceiling tiles
  • Wallpaper
  • Fabrics
  • Upholstery
  • Some Painted surfaces
  • Paper
  • Cardboard
  • And More

Our mold inspectors use the latest technology and have detailed knowledge of home construction to examine the air and surfaces for the presence of mold. Our mold testing will give you better insights into the current state of your home regarding mold infestation and the recommended actions you can take to address the problem. Our process includes:

  • Initial Assessment: The mold inspector obtains data about the home, any known mold issues, and your concerns during the initial consultation to develop a plan for mold testing.
  • Visual Inspection: The inspector will execute a visual inspection of the property, evaluating for any noticeable signs of mold infestation. They will examine areas of the house that are known to be vulnerable to mold growth, such as basements, bathrooms, and kitchens.
  • Moisture detection: Knowing moisture content in areas around the house is important in discovering likely sources of mold growth. Moisture meters and other tools are used to measure the moisture levels inside building materials and detect areas with high humidity or water intrusion behind walls, under flooring, or in other concealed spaces. Infrared tools may be used to identify areas where mold infestation may be occurring.
  • Air Sampling: Air sampling is often conducted to determine indoor air quality and ascertain the amount of floating mold spores. Air filters and extraction devices are employed to gather air samples from various areas of the house. The samples are then dispatched to a lab for evaluation.
  • Surface Sampling: The inspector may also take surface samples from spaces of the house where mold is suspected. These samples will be dispatched to a lab for evaluation to ascertain the type of mold detected.
  • Documentation and Reporting: A comprehensive report will be supplied to clients after the mold inspection is done, including any areas of the home where mold was detected, the type of mold present, and suggestions for mitigation.
  • Recommendations and Remediation Plan: Based on the inspection results, the inspector offers suggestions to tackle the mold problem and avoid further growth.
  • Follow-up and Clearance Testing: A follow-up assessment may be executed to assure you that the restoration efforts were productive and that the mold issue has been adequately addressed.
  • Education and Prevention: The inspector educates the client about mold precaution measures, including adequate airflow, moisture control, and maintenance practices.

Are There Any Actions I Should Take To Help My Mold Inspector Perform His Work and Get Accurate Test Results?

The most significant way you can help your mold inspector prior to their visit is to clear all obstacles that might impede their ability to conduct the test. This includes keeping pets away from their path and taking away clutter, furniture, or additional objects that make it challenging for them to access various parts of the house.
